Total knee arthroplasty in the octogenarian
B Zicat1, C H Rorabeck, R B Bourne
1Department of Orthopaedic Surgery, University of Western Ontario, University Hospital, London, Canada.
The Journal of Arthroplasty
|August 1, 1993
Summary
Total knee arthroplasty is a reliable procedure for octogenarians (patients 80+). Elderly patients experienced similar outcomes to younger groups, demonstrating cost-effectiveness despite minor post-discharge cost increases.

Background:
- Osteoarthritis affects a growing elderly population, necessitating effective treatment options.
- Total knee arthroplasty (TKA) is a common surgical intervention for advanced osteoarthritis.
- Assessing TKA outcomes in octogenarians is crucial due to unique physiological considerations.
Purpose of the Study:
- To compare the clinical outcomes and cost-effectiveness of TKA in patients aged 80 and over versus a younger cohort (65-69 years).
- To evaluate the reliability and safety of TKA in an elderly population.
Main Methods:
- Prospective comparative study involving 50 octogenarian and 50 younger patients undergoing TKA.
- Clinical assessment using Hospital for Special Surgery (HSS) knee scores and radiographic evaluation.
- Minimum 2-year follow-up period for all participants.
Main Results:
- No significant differences in pain, function, strength, stability, or range of motion between octogenarians and the younger group over 2 years.
- Octogenarians presented with more prevalent and larger preoperative deformities, indicating more advanced disease.
- Slightly higher post-discharge costs were observed in the octogenarian group, while in-hospital costs and length of stay were comparable.
Conclusions:
- Total knee arthroplasty is a reliable and effective procedure for octogenarians with osteoarthritis.
- The procedure demonstrates good cost-effectiveness in the elderly population, similar to younger patients.
- Preoperative deformities are more common and severe in octogenarians, suggesting advanced osteoarthritis pathophysiology.
